Bed occupancy rate

The beds occupancy


rate is calculated based
on the midnight bed
census at each hospital.
Occupancy rate =
Total number of
inpatient days for a
given period x 100 /
Available beds x
Number of days in
the period
the number of hospital
beds occupied by
patients expressed as a
percentage of the total
beds available in the
ward, specialty,
hospital, area, or region.
It is used to assess the
demands for hospital
beds and hence to
gauge an appropriate
balance between
demands for health care
and number of beds.

Tubal ligation is an
operation to stop a
woman from getting
pregnant. It is
PERMANENT.
Therefore, you
should only consider
this procedure if you
are sure you will
never want another
child. The Fallopian
tubes, which carry
the eggs from the
ovary to the womb
(uterus), are
burned, clipped, cut
or tied (the tubes
are sealed). The
tubes are therefore
closed so the sperm
and egg do not
meet. The egg then
dissolves and is
absorbed by the
body.

An implant is a
small flexible rod
that is placed just
under your skin in
your upper arm. It
releases a
progestogen
hormone similar to
the natural
progesterone that
women produce in
their ovaries and
works for up to three
years.

Stroke
or
Cerebral
Vascular
Accident (CVA)
A stroke is the sudden death of brain
cells due to a problem with the blood
supply. When blood flow to the brain
is impaired, oxygen and important
nutrients cannot be delivered. The
result is injury and then death to
brain cells resulting in abnormal brain
function. Blood flow to the brain can
be disrupted by either a blockage or
rupture of an artery to the brain.

Pelvic inflammatory disease (PID) is an infection of the female reproductive organs. It


usually occurs when sexually transmitted bacteria spread from your vagina to your
uterus, fallopian tubes or ovaries.
Many women who develop pelvic inflammatory disease either experience no signs or
symptoms or don't seek treatment. Pelvic inflammatory disease may be detected only
later when you have trouble getting pregnant or if you develop chronic pelvic pain.
